The Church of St. John offers Preschool Faith Formation for children ages 3, 4 and 5. Classes meet approximately three Sundays a month from 9:30-10:30 a.m. All parents are encouraged to volunteer with classroom activities.
Our goal with the Preschool program is to foster an environment for young children to interact and meet new friends, and to enhance what the children are already learning about God at home from parents and family members.

Through Sadlier's text, Discovering God's Child, three year olds explore God's gift of ourselves as they cover the four basic units of the text: God gives us our friends, God's gift of Ourselves, God's gift of our world, and Growing as God's Child. Students learn the importance of the many gifts God has given us - family, friends, our senses and much more! By the end of the year three year olds will learn the basics of caring for al living things and belonging to their special family - the Church. And - all this is learned through interactive play, stories, games, singing and crafts!
Through Sadlier's text, Discovering God's World, four year olds explore God's gift of creation as they cover the four basic units of the text: God's gift of people, God's gift of our world, God's gift of ourselves, and Living in God's family. Children learn the importance of showing love at home and in preschool, to appreciate and care for God's creation, ourselves and others, and about the gift of Baptism and the Mass. By the end of the year four year olds will learn a little more about the wonderful world God has blessed us with. And - all this is learned through interactive play, stories, games, singing and crafts!
Through Sadlier's text, Discovering God's Love, five year olds explore God's gift of love with family and Church community as they cover the basic units of the text: God made us and loves us, I am wonderfully made by God, Belonging to my family, and Growing in God's family. Children learn that God helps us to grow in love and trust, people are the greatest of all that God made, and God loves us through our families. By the end of the year five year olds will also learn to pray and celebrate their special family, the Church. And - all this is learned through interactive play, stories, games, singing and crafts!

Children in grades K-3 are invited to participate in the Children’s Liturgy of the Word during the 9:30 a.m. Liturgy. No registration is required. Children will be invited to join the facilitators after the opening prayer and will return to join their families in church after the Prayer of the Faithful.
In addition to pre-school and Children’s Liturgy of the Word on Sunday mornings during 9:30 Mass, we are pleased to announce that child care is available to children (12 months to 3 years) during the 9:30 Mass. We hope that this will enable your family to participate more fully in Sunday worship.
No registration is required for child care or for Children’s Liturgy of the Word. Child care will be drop-off/pick-up (room 104), and Children’s Liturgy of the Word will continue as in the past in the music room for children kindergarten-Grade 3. For more information, contact Maggie DeStazio.

Vacation Bible School (VBS) for Pre-K and Kindergarten through fourth grade runs for a full week in during the Summer.
The purpose of this group is to give children a fun-filled week aimed at celebrating God's love. Activities include scripture plays, music, crafts, snacks, free-time and special events.
